    If you call Dometic customer service and tell them you need the upgraded thermostat they'll send it to you pronto. No need for warranty or dealer. I called and asked for 2 new faceplates, they sent 2 complete thermostat assemblies, at my door in a few days.

    Just finish my first dry camping adventure. A couple things I need to address. I filled up the fresh water before I left home, but by the time I got to the camp site, I was down 25% according to the control panel. Some people talked about the overflow tube and mentioned about installing a shut off valve to keep the water from siphoning out. I'm not sure if that's what happened, but something I will pay attention to next time. Also, the black tank is not reading correct, but we are taking another road trip in a week, so I am going to try a few of the posted "remedies" and make sure it's really clean before we break camp. I was camping solo, so both issues were pretty minor. Other than that, more trips are planned, just have to suffer at work until then.
